|
Ph.D. Thesis: Lifetime Reliability-Aware
Microprocessors
New email address:
jayanth(underscore)srinivasan(at)mckinsey(dot)com
I'm a Ph.D. student in the Computer Science Department at the University of Illinois at Urbana Champaign.
I work with Sarita Adve in the RSIM Computer Architecture Group.
I've performed much of my PhD research as a co-op at IBM T.J. Watson Research Center in Yorktown Heights, NY.
Currently, I'm also an IBM PhD fellow.
Computer architecture, specifically, technology constraints for future architectures, and adaptive processors and systems.
| Educational Background
  |
University of Illinois, Urbana-Champaign
Ph.D. in Computer Science (Expected May 2005)
Thesis: Lifetime Reliability Awareness for Microprocessors
Advisor: Sarita Adve
University of Illinois, Urbana-Champaign
M.S. in Computer Science (Dec 2002)
Thesis: Architectural Adaptation for Thermal Control
Advisor: Sarita Adve
Indian Institute of Technology, Madras
B.Tech. in Electrical Enginnering (May 2000)
| Research Experience
  |
University of Illinois, Urbana-Champaign, Department of Computer Science (Sept 2000 - present)
Graduate research assistant in RSIM Computer Architecture Group
Advisor: Sarita Adve
IBM T.J. Watson Research Center, Yorktown Heights, NY (Apr 2004 - Sept 2004)
Co-op in newly formed Reliability and Power-Aware Microarchitectures Group
Managers: Pradip Bose, Jaime Moreno
IBM T.J. Watson Research Center, Yorktown Heights, NY (May 2003 - Sept 2003)
Graduate intern in Computer Architecture Group
Managers: Pradip Bose, Phil Emma, Jaime Moreno
Intel Microarchitecture Research Labs, Austin, TX (May 2002 - Sept 2002)
Graduate intern
Managers: Bryan Black, John Shen
Most of the copyrights for the papers below belong to either ACM or IEEE.
Please use only for private use.
1. "Lifetime Reliability: Toward an Architectural
Solution" J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, in May/June
2005
issue (Vol. 25, No. 3) of IEEE Micro, Special Issue on Future Trends in
Microarchitecture
2. The Importance of Heat-Sink Modeling for
DTM and a Correction to "Predictive DTM for Multimedia Applications" J.
Srinivasan, S. V. Adve, to appear in the 4th Annual Workshop on Duplicating,
Deconstructing, and Debunking (WDDD) at ISCA-05, , June 2005.
3. "Exploiting Structural Duplication for Lifetime
Reliability Enhancement" J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, to appear in the 32nd
International Symposium on Computer Architecture (ISCA-2005),
June 2005.
4. "Lifetime Reliability Awareness for Microprocessors," J. Srinivasan, S.V.
Adve, P. Bose, J. A. Rivers, Poster to appear at the IBM Austin
Conference on Energy-Efficient Design (ACEED), Mar. 2005.
5. "A Reliability Odometer - Lemon Check Your Processor!," J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, Wild and Crazy Ideas Session at the International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S), Boston, Oct. 2004.
6. "The Case for Lifetime Reliability-Aware Microprocessors," J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, 31st International Symposium on Computer Architecture (ISCA-2004), Munich, Germany, June 2004.
7. "The Impact of Technology Scaling on Lifetime Reliability," J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, International Conference on Dependable Systems and Networks (DSN-2004), Florence, Italy, June 2004.
8. "Predictive Dynamic Thermal Management for Multimedia Applications," J. Srinivasan, S. V. Adve, Proceedings of the 17th Annual ACM International Conference on Supercomputing (ICS'03), San Francisco, CA, June 2003.
9. "The Illinois GRACE Project: Global Resource Adaptation through CoopEration," S. V. Adve, A. F. Harris, C. J. Hughes, D. L. Jones, R. H. Kravets, K. Nahrstedt, D. G. Sachs, R. Sasanka, J. Srinivasan, W. Yuan, Proceedings of the Workshop on Self-Healing, Adaptive, and self-MANaged Systems (SHAMAN) (held in conjunction with the 16th Annual ACM International Conference on Supercomputing), New York City, NY, June 2002.
10. "Saving Energy with Architectural and Frequency Adaptations for Multimedia Applications," C. J. Hughes, J. Srinivasan, S. V. Adve, Proceedings of the 34th International Symposium on Microarchitecture (MICRO-34), Austin, TX, December 2001.
11. "Variability in the Execution of Multimedia Applications and Implications for Architecture," C. J. Hughes, P. Kaul, S. V. Adve, R. Jain, C. Park, J. Srinivasan, Proceedings of the 28th International Symposium on Computer Architecture, Goteborg, Sweden, June 2001 (ISCA-01).
12. "The Case for Microarchitectural Lifetime-Reliability Awareness," J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, Under preparation for submission to ACM Transactions on Architecture and Code Optimization (TACO) (invited paper) (Please email me for pre-print).
13. "Providing Predictable Performance vs. Energy/Temperature Tradeoffs for Multimedia Applications", C. J. Hughes, R. Sasanka, J. Srinivasan, S. V. Adve, Under preparation for journal submission. (Please email me for pre-print)
14. "RAMP: A Model For Reliability Aware MicroProcessor Design," J. Srinivasan, S. V. Adve, P. Bose, J. A. Rivers, C.-K. Hu, IBM Research Report, RC23048, December, 2003.
More recent and accurate models and a better scaling analysis can be found in the ISCA-2004 and DSN-2004 papers.
1. "System and Method of Workload-Dependent Reliability Projection and Monitoring for Microprocessor Chips and Systems," J. Srinivasan, P. Bose, J. A. Rivers, IBM invention disclosure filed, Patent pending, Nov. 2003.
2. "Method and Apparatus for Monitoring and Enhancing On-Chip Microprocessor Reliability," J. Srinivasan, P. Bose, J. A. Rivers, IBM invention disclosure filed, Patent pending, Nov. 2003.
1. "A Reliability Odometer - Lemon Check Your Processor!," Wild and Crazy Ideas Session at the International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S), Boston, Oct. 2004.
2. "Architectural Hard Error Tolerance," CMOS Design Forum, IBM T. J. Watson Research Center, Yorktown Heights, NY, Aug 2004.
3. "The Impact of Scaling on Lifetime Reliability,"The International Conference on Dependable Systems and Networks, Florence, Italy, June 2004.
4. "The Case for Lifetime Reliability-Aware Microprocessors," 31st International Symposium on Computer Architecture, Munich, Germany, June 2004.
5. "Reliability Aware Micro-architectures," CMOS Design Forum, IBM T.J. Watson Research Center, Yorktown Heights, NY, September 2003.
6. "Predictive Dynamic Thermal Management for Multimedia Applications," 17th Annual ACM Intl. Conference on Supercomputing (ICS'03), San Francisco, CA, June 2003.
7. "Architectural Adaptation for Thermal Control," Dept. of Electrical Engineering, Indian Institute of Technology, Madras, Jan 2003 (Invited Talk)
8. "Adaptive Architectures for Multimedia Applications," Dept. of Electrical Engineering, Indian Institute of Technology, Madras, Jan 2002. (Invited Talk)
Jayanth Srinivasan
Email: srinivsn (at) cs.uiuc.edu
Ph: 217-377-5186
Fax: 217-265-6582
Home Address
1007, W.Clark St., #1,
Urbana, IL - 61801.
Office Address
Siebel Center for Computer Science,
University of Illinois, Urbana-Champaign,
201, N. Goodwin Avenue,
Urbana, IL - 61801.
|